About this Item

An assembled set of George III silver Old English Thread pattern flatware, Richard Crossley, William Eley & William Fearn, London, 1785-1804
comprising: twelve dinner forks, twelve dessert forks, twelve dessert spoons, 1890g all in; twelve Elizabeth II silver and stainless steel dinner knives and twelve bread knives, Terry Shaverin, Sheffield, 1997
(60)
